Transcutaneous spinal stimulation for reducing lower limb spasticity in chronic spinal cord injury

  • Objective: To determine if electrical neuromodulation can reduce muscle stiffness and spasms in people with spinal cord injury in a home-based therapy setting.
  • Lead Investigator: Matthias J. Krenn, Ph.D.
  • Related Publications: New
  • Funding: Paralyzed Veterans of America

Defining the capacity of the lumbosacral network for neuromodulation in humans with spinal cord injury

  • Objective: To determine how electrical neuromodulation affects the responsiveness of the lumbosacral network in people with spinal cord injuries. We aim to understand how spinal reflexes can demonstrate the potential for neuromodulation at different stimulation intensities and frequencies.
  • Principal Investigator: Matthias J. Krenn, Ph.D.
  • Related Publications: New
  • Funding: Wings for Life USA – Spinal Cord Research Foundation Inc.
